Output 3340cca7c251aa00d162b6ddd3c52e65429f14c98651830a8311150a5db8efde:0

value
690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8907b3aabd247072d59edfa611fb721f9bedb543 OP_EQUAL
address
3EBZixSNjaPunizRVM77XXMvaQFRYvkStR
transaction
3340cca7c251aa00d162b6ddd3c52e65429f14c98651830a8311150a5db8efde
spent
true